The Bitter Farewell: Dissecting Russ's 'GoodBye'

Russ's song 'GoodBye' is a raw and emotional portrayal of a breakup, filled with frustration and a sense of betrayal. The lyrics suggest a relationship that has ended not just in separation but in a deep disappointment, as the singer addresses an ex-partner who has been unfaithful. The repeated refrain of 'Goodbye' emphasizes the finality of the separation, while the verses detail the singer's grievances and the pain caused by the partner's actions.

The song takes a narrative approach, with Russ recounting specific incidents and naming individuals who have been involved with his ex-partner. The mention of names like Paul, Paola, Blake, Devon, and Igor, along with the revelation that the ex-partner is a prostitute, paints a picture of deceit and infidelity. Russ's lyrics express a sense of having been fooled and the realization that his love was misplaced. The aggressive tone and language used in the song convey the anger and hurt that come with such a realization, as well as a determination to move on from the toxic relationship.

The cultural references in 'GoodBye' add depth to the song's narrative. Russ's mention of calling the ex-partner from the Grammys suggests a future where he has achieved success and moved beyond the pain of the past relationship. This line serves as a form of empowerment, indicating that despite the hurt, the singer will continue to thrive and succeed without the ex-partner. The song is a cathartic release of emotion, serving as both a personal closure and a public declaration of independence from a damaging relationship.
